Option 1: mineral wool

Mineral wool is a rolled or slab material, which consists of fine mineral fibers. The latter are obtained by melting and spraying rocks or blast-furnace slag.

To insulate the balcony from the inside in a frame way, you can use glass wool, which is cheaper than basalt wool. In this case, during its installation, it is necessary to carefully protect the respiratory organs, eyes and hands.

Advantages:

  1. Versatility. Basalt wool can be used to insulate the balcony inside and out. Moreover, the insulation of surfaces can be carried out both in a frame way and wet:
    • Let me remind you that for frame insulation, panel or sheet finishing materials are used - drywall, plastic panels, lining, siding, etc.;
    • When finishing with a wet method, the surface of the insulation is plastered;
    • Plates of high density grades can even be laid under a screed for floor insulation;
  1. Environmental friendliness. Basalt wool does not contain harmful substances, and even during installation, unlike glass wool, it practically does not cause irritation on the skin;
  2. Vapor permeability. Insulation allows the walls to "breathe", thanks to which a favorable microclimate is formed in the room;
  3. Fire safety. Mineral wool does not burn and can withstand high temperatures.

Disadvantages:

  • Absorbs moisture. When performing work on insulation, it is necessary to ensure high-quality vapor and waterproofing;
  • Price. The price of basalt wool is higher than some other heaters.

Option 2: Styrofoam

Expanded polystyrene, or simply polystyrene, is a polymer insulation in the form of plates formed by small granules.

Characteristics:

Advantages:

  • Light weight. Styrofoam is the lightest slab insulation;
  • Low price. The cost is much lower than the price of basalt wool;
  • Versatility. Like basalt wool, it can be used for insulation in any way, both from the inside and outside;
  • Moisture resistant. The material absorbs moisture to a lesser extent than mineral wool.

Disadvantages:

  • Zero vapor permeability. This disadvantage can lead to an increase in indoor humidity, mold on the walls, etc. High-quality ventilation will help to eliminate it;

  • Fire hazard. Styrofoam manufacturers, especially little-known ones, rarely add fire retardants to the foam polystyrene composition. Therefore, it ignites quite easily and burns well;
  • Low strength and brittleness. This drawback matters if the insulation boards are plastered after installation. Surfaces insulated in this way are unstable to shock loads;
  • Low environmental friendliness. Styrofoam itself does not threaten health in any way, but in the process of burning it releases toxins. Inhalation of these substances leads to severe poisoning.

Option 3: Extruded Styrofoam

Extruded polystyrene foam, also known as polystyrene foam, is made from the same raw materials as regular foam. However, thanks to a special insulation technology, it has higher characteristics.

Characteristics:

Advantages. From the data in the table it can be seen that the penoplex has a low thermal conductivity and high strength. In addition, it has some other advantages:

  • Moisture resistance: Penoplex absolutely does not absorb water, therefore it does not need waterproofing;
  • Fire safety. All well-known manufacturers add flame retardants to the composition of this material, which makes the insulation for the balcony low-flammable.

Disadvantages:

  • High price. For this reason, it makes sense to use penoplex only in cases where a large load will be placed on it, for example, in the case of wet insulation of walls and ceilings. You can also perform thermal insulation of the floor under the screed;
  • Low vapor permeability. The vapor permeability coefficient of foam plastic is slightly higher than that of polystyrene, however, the material is still not "breathable".

Option 4: polyurethane foam

Polyurethane foam is another type of polymer insulation. His main feature is that it is applied to the surface in the form of foam.

Characteristics:

Polyurethane foam is also used for insulating balconies in the form of mounting foam. With its help, thermal insulation of various cracks is performed.

Advantages:

  • Low thermal conductivity. As can be seen from the table, polyurethane foam has the lowest thermal conductivity. In addition, it is applied to the surface in a continuous layer, due to which it retains heat in the room more efficiently;
  • Moisture resistant. Thanks to this quality, it does not require the use of waterproofing;
  • Good adhesion. This allows you to apply insulation on any surface.

Disadvantages.

  • Requires special equipment. Polyurethane foam cannot be applied by hand. This procedure should be carried out exclusively by highly qualified specialists with special equipment;

  • Zero vapor permeability. Like others polymeric heaters, the material does not breathe;
  • Increase in thermal conductivity over time. The gas that fills the structure of the polyurethane foam gradually leaves the shell. As a result, its thermal conductivity increases slightly;
  • High price. In addition to the cost of the material itself, the cost of insulation work is added to its price;

  • The impossibility of plastering. To finish the balcony from the inside or outside, in the case of using polyurethane foam, it is possible only in the frame way;
  • Toxic in liquid form. When working with polyurethane, it is necessary to use personal protective equipment, as it is toxic. After hardening, the material is safe for health.

Price. Different manufacturers have different prices for polyurethane foam insulation. On average, the cost, taking into account work, is about 500 rubles. for 1m2

Option 5: penofol

Penofol is a thin roll insulation, which consists of two layers:

  • Foamed polyethylene - performs the function of a heat-insulating material;
  • Foil - reflects heat from insulated surfaces into the room.

Thus, this material is used only for internal insulation of balconies and loggias.

Characteristics:

Advantages:

  • Little weight. The material is easily attached to any structure;
  • Moisture resistant. This allows you to use penofol as a waterproofing material if, for example, you insulate a balcony or loggia with mineral wool;
  • Small thickness. Due to this, the material does not take up additional space in the room.

Instructions for the use of penofol require its location during installation with the foil side to the room. Otherwise, the material will not reflect heat from the surfaces.

Disadvantages:

  • Zero vapor permeability. I have already spoken of the consequences of this deficiency;
  • High thermal conductivity. Penofol is a thin material, so it is not enough to fully insulate the room. Therefore, it is usually used as additional thermal insulation.

Price. The price starts from 50-80 rubles per 1m2.

How to insulate the floor on the balcony

About a quarter of the heat loss on the balcony occurs through the floor, so work needs to be done to prevent these losses. This is not the most difficult operation and it is quite possible to do it yourself. When choosing a material, it should be taken into account that the level of the floor on the balcony after installation must be at or below the level of the floor in the adjoining room.

There are several simple and affordable ways:

  • with a frame device;
  • monolithic;
  • electric underfloor heating.

Professional skills may require only one - the installation of a warm floor.

Underfloor heating on the balcony

The main point in the choice of method and material is the condition of the carrier plate. In houses of old construction, structures may have wear and tear and are not always ready to withstand heavy loads. Therefore, it is important to coordinate with the specialists of the department of architecture, what weight of materials can be used in the repair. This is especially important when installing monolithic concrete floors.

The frame floor, in turn, can be arranged using:

  • mineral wool;
  • expanded clay;
  • pepoplast;
  • foam or expanded polystyrene.

Floor insulation technology consists of several stages.

  1. Leveling the surface of the plate is carried out if necessary.
  2. Waterproofing with a polyethylene film or roofing material (for damp rooms).
  3. The device of a wooden crate. A bar with a height close to the thickness of the insulation is used. It is laid along the length of the balcony at a distance of 50 cm from each other or another convenient distance, depending on the size of the insulation sheets. Leave indents from the walls of 5-7 cm, and the ends - 5 cm, so that when high humidity wood is not deformed. They are fixed to the floor with anchors or self-tapping screws with a depth of at least 4 mm. This will provide a stable hold. If it is necessary to install transverse beams, it is necessary to make cuts up to half the thickness at the joints and make recesses with the help of which the transverse logs are connected to the longitudinal ones. Control the level, do not allow the bars to sag. If necessary, wooden wedges or dies are placed, which are fixed to the floor with mounting foam. It is important to prevent foam from entering the junction of the wedge and the timber.
  4. Filling the crate is made with the selected insulation.

Cheap and efficient material mineral wool. Available in rolls and slabs, light in weight, easy to install. The size of the canvas is chosen in such a way as not to crumple it and not to bend it. This degrades the protective qualities due to the reduction in the amount of air between the fibers. The main disadvantage of mineral wool is its low moisture resistance, so it is necessary to use a vapor barrier as the next layer.

Popular, inexpensive Styrofoam due to the ease and ease of installation, it is most often used as a heater. It is very hygroscopic and resistant to any environment. Among the disadvantages are deformation under loads and poor sound insulation.

Balcony floor insulation with polystyrene foam

Penoplex it is resistant to mold development, mechanical stress, temperature changes and excellent thermal insulation performance. As disadvantages, you can cancel its combustibility with the release of harmful substances and the thickness of the material.

Insulation of the floor and walls of the balcony with foam

High fire resistance, durability expanded clay. But it is not very good for warming a balcony, since a thick layer is required for normal thermal insulation.

Insulation of the balcony floor with expanded clay

  • The gaps remaining after filling with a heater are foamed.
  • On top of the insulation or vapor barrier (if applicable), as a rough flooring, after which the selected floor material will follow, chipboard or moisture-resistant plywood is attached.

Cement screed is used only with a fairly solid balcony structure. In order not to exceed the permissible load, a reinforced screed up to 50 mm thick is used.

How to fix materials

When using flooring waterproofing materials they are glued to special compounds or (like roofing felt) they are fastened with heating of the connected parts with a burner from the fastening side.

The choice of method for fixing thermal insulation depends on the material used.

Styrofoam or polystyrene boards can be glued or mounted on plastic dowels. If glue is used, it is very important to choose the right composition, excluding toluene, which is contraindicated for use with such heaters.

Glue is applied to the mounting pad, a thin layer over the entire area. For application it is convenient to use a notched trowel. Additionally, it is possible to apply glue dropwise on the heat-insulating boards in several places.

When using dowels, they are installed along the perimeter of the slab at the rate of 8-10 points per square meter. For perfectionists, we can recommend using both fasteners at the same time: additionally fasten the initially glued plates to plastic dowels.

To seal the seams between the insulation boards, a mounting foam that does not contain toluene is used. The seams between the elements of the waterproofing layer are closed with a special self-adhesive sealant.

Mineral wool in most cases is attached only to dowels. Vapor barrier (inner layer of waterproofing) is installed together with heaters on dowels or glued directly onto thermal insulation materials.

Where does condensation form on the insulated loggia?

If you notice this negative phenomenon, most likely there is an unheated room under your loggia. Another option is insufficient thermal insulation of the outer walls.

Experts distinguish the concept of dew point - this is the temperature of air cooling at which water vapor is boundary saturated. That is, at this temperature, the relative humidity of the gas reaches 100%.

Condensation is caused by air cooling or the influx of water vapor.

Explain on practical example. If something is brought into the room from the cold, the air above it can cool to a temperature below the dew point under conditions of a certain humidity and air temperature.

In this case, condensation forms on the surface.

For typical rooms, you can roughly calculate the dew point as follows.

If the temperature of the underfloor heating on the screed is 30 degrees and the relative humidity is 60%, the dew point will be 21.4 degrees. That is, when the underfloor heating is turned off, condensate will appear when the cement is cooled to this value.

To solve the problem, you can use one of two options:

  • reduce air humidity, for which air dehumidifiers are used, electric convectors and similar equipment;
  • keep the screed temperature above the dew point.

Proper insulation of the balcony

Most of our apartments are too cramped for living and many people resort to connecting rooms with kitchens, balconies, loggias, trying in this way to expand the living space. Therefore, questions about proper insulation balconies are always relevant.

If we start from the laws of physics, then the insulation of balconies must be carried out on the cold side of the building envelope of any surface. At the same time, the old fence is in the zone of positive temperatures, and moisture vapor from a warm room easily passes through the insulation, does not accumulate and does not linger, but penetrates.

The multi-layer construction, together with the insulation, works reliably, and the heat-insulating characteristics do not decrease. If all the work was done correctly, the best materials were chosen, it will be very comfortable in such an apartment, which received additional usable space due to the balcony.

But in many houses, external insulation is often not possible. Therefore, it is necessary to resort to internal insulation of balconies and loggias.

At first glance, this is the simplest task. It is enough to buy a heater, glue it to the wall, sheathe it with sheet materials, install a heat source - and that's all, long years comfort and warmth provided.

Everything is not as simple as it seems.

If you have already insulated your balcony or loggia in this way, you probably noticed that in cold weather condensation appears near the wall - water taken from nowhere.

Condensation on the floor - where does it come from?

Internal insulation of a heated balcony transfers the building envelope to the area of ​​negative temperatures, which are always below the dew point. At the same time, moisture vapor from a warm room (when moving from an area of ​​high to an area of ​​low partial pressure) passes through the installed heat-insulating layer as more loose and stops at a dense cold fence. Steam condenses on a cold plane. Further, after the transition of the steam to a drop-liquid state, depending on the weather conditions and microclimatic indicators in the apartment, the process turns into the wetting of the fence and insulation.

The insulation loses a significant part of its heat-saving characteristics, with an increase in wetting, the material becomes unable to retain water and it flows out of the wall.

Even if water does not flow out of the wall, this is not a reason to rejoice, because the thermal insulation gets wet anyway, its properties are lost. Are being created favorable conditions for mold growth. Thus, the meaning of insulation is lost - it seems to be there, but at the same time it is not there.

And what to do, how to avoid such troubles?

There is a way out of this situation. We will consider two solutions that allow you to insulate a balcony or loggia from the inside and at the same time avoid the described phenomenon.

According to the first option, you will need to install a special vapor barrier in front of the heater. This will prevent the penetration of water vapor into the insulation. This is a reliable method even when using insulation with maximum vapor permeability (for example, if mineral wool is used for thermal insulation). For this option, dry construction technology is recommended, which occurs according to the method of wall cladding.

At the same time, instead of drywall and metal profiles, it is enough to use bars and Wall panels PVC or MDF.

The vapor barrier is polyethylene film, foil or membranes specially designed for such tasks. Internal insulation involves the installation of a structure in the form of a “pie” with the same order of layers (the same for walls, floors and ceilings).

The advantage of the first method is that there are practically no wet processes during operation, with the exception of the stage of filling the seams and joints between the gypsum boards. The disadvantage of the method is the lack of the ability to “breathe” in such a system.

According to the second option, the vapor barrier is not installed separately, but the insulation is performed using certain materials with minimal vapor permeability. These materials include conventional and extruded polystyrene foam.

According to the second method, mineral wool, which has too high vapor permeability, cannot be used.

In this case, it is necessary to choose such a thickness of the insulation at which moisture will not accumulate - that is, at which the necessary resistance to vapor permeation is provided.

Let's take an example. When using ordinary expanded polystyrene with a density value of 25 kg / m3, according to the standards given in SNiP, the thickness of the insulation should be from 80 mm. This thickness will also provide good heat saving.

If extruded polystyrene foam is used, then the calculation is carried out taking into account the much lower vapor permeability of such material (3-10 times, depending on the manufacturer, lower than that of conventional polystyrene foam). Accordingly, a 30 mm layer of such insulation is sufficient to achieve the same result.

But this thickness is insufficient if we talk about the thermal protection of the room. To achieve optimal performance, it is recommended to install extruded polystyrene foam with a thickness of 50-60 mm. In general, to determine the required thickness of the insulation, it is required to carry out a heat engineering calculation of the building envelope, which takes into account local standards and climatic features.

Both types of expanded polystyrene are attached to a brick or concrete base using special compounds. For example, you can use Knauf-Sevener or Ceresit ST85.

When the primary hardening of the glue has occurred, the plates are also fixed with dowels-fungi.

On the surface of expanded polystyrene plates, it is necessary to equip a protective reinforced layer, created from the same adhesive composition.

The glue is applied to a sheet of expanded polystyrene, which must first be processed with coarse sandpaper. Layer thickness 2-3 mm. Alkali-resistant fiberglass mesh with a mesh size of 5x5 mm is embedded in this layer. Immediately on top of the grid you need to apply a second layer of adhesive.

The fiberglass mesh should be inside between the layers of glue, it should not be applied immediately to the insulation and glued to it with glue. In this case, it will not be able to perform the reinforcement function assigned to it.

When the reinforced layer hardens, you can start puttying the surface, and then paint it, glue wallpaper, plaster decorative compositions with different textures, etc.
